What does a company's dividend payout ratio show?

  1. A The proportion of earnings distributed to shareholders
  2. B The dividend yield on the share price
  3. C Total dividends paid over five years
  4. D The growth rate of dividends
Answer

The proportion of earnings distributed to shareholders

Payout ratio equals dividends divided by net income. The remainder is the retention ratio, which funds reinvestment and future growth.
